Second teen struck near Mountain RoadPublished 11/14/08
For the second time in 24 hours, a teenager was struck by a car and critically injured yesterday while walking near Mountain Road in Pasadena. In the latest accident, at least one passerby ran to the boy's aid and pulled him from under the vehicle before paramedics arrived at the scene, said Division Chief Michael Cox, a county Fire Department spokesman. The 15-year-old boy was walking on Edwin Raynor Boulevard at Mountain Road at 5:50 p.m. when he was struck.
